Lets compare vitamin content per 100 grams of Oil Roasted Almonds vs Frozen Peas And Carrots:
- 100 grams of Oil Roasted Almonds have 9.6 times more Vitamin B2 and 2.6 times more Vitamin B3 than Frozen Peas And Carrots.
- While 100 g of Frozen Peas And Carrots, Unprepared contain more Vitamin A, 2.1 times more Vitamin B1, 1.3 times more Vitamin B9 and more Vitamin C than Oil Roasted Almonds.
- Both Oil Roasted Almonds and Frozen Peas And Carrots provide similar amounts of Vitamin B5 and Vitamin B6 per 100 grams.
- 100 grams of Oil Roasted Almonds have insufficient amounts of Vitamin A and Vitamin C
- Both Oil Roasted Almonds as well as Frozen Peas And Carrots, Unprepared have insufficient amounts of Vitamin B12 and Vitamin D in 100 grams.
Comparing minerals per 100 grams for Oil Roasted Almonds vs Frozen Peas And Carrots:
- 100 grams of Oil Roasted Almonds have 10.8 times more Calcium, 10.7 times more Copper, 3.4 times more Iron, 15.2 times more Magnesium, 10.5 times more Manganese, 7.8 times more Phosphorus, 3.6 times more Potassium, 3.4 times more Selenium and 5.9 times more Zinc than Frozen Peas And Carrots.
- While 100 g of Frozen Peas And Carrots, Unprepared contain 79 times more Sodium and 30.1 times more Water than Oil Roasted Almonds.
Comparison of macro-nutrients per 100 grams:
- 100 grams of Oil Roasted Almonds have 11.5 times more Energy, 117.4 times more Fat, 50.1 times more Saturated Fat, 74.7 times more Omega 6, 1.6 times more Carbohydrate, 3.1 times more Fiber and 6.2 times more Protein than Frozen Peas And Carrots.
- While 100 g of Frozen Peas And Carrots, Unprepared contain more Omega 3 than Oil Roasted Almonds.
- 100 grams of Oil Roasted Almonds provide inadequate amounts of Omega 3
- 100 grams of Frozen Peas And Carrots provide inadequate amounts of Energy and Omega 6
